Output 840665030dfdd2390c1287b20aab162e4733c1a51a83616bda74319944fdcb68:0

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 3d3c57dd8add03c5c918a04043dbe15702520c01
address
bc1q85790hv2m5putjgc5pqy8klp2up9yrqpf33zyt
transaction
840665030dfdd2390c1287b20aab162e4733c1a51a83616bda74319944fdcb68
spent
false